The following forms are included: Restated Certificate of Incorporation, Due Diligence Checklist, Investor Rights Agreement, Standard Term Sheet, Series A Preferred Stock Purchase Agreement, Investor Stock Purchase Agreement, Right of First Refusal and Co-Sale Agreement, Voting Agreement Among Stockholders to Elect Directors, Bridge Financing Promissory Note, Term Sheet for Venture Capital Investment, and Common Stock Purchase Warrant.
The Texas Venture Capital Package is a comprehensive initiative designed to foster entrepreneurial growth and attract investor capital to the state of Texas. This package encompasses a range of incentives, programs, and resources aimed at supporting startups, emerging companies, and innovative ideas across various industries. One of the main goals of the Texas Venture Capital Package is to create a conducive environment for venture capitalists to invest in Texas-based startups and high-growth companies. The state recognizes the crucial role venture capital plays in driving job creation, economic development, and technological advancements. By offering attractive incentives and a supportive ecosystem, Texas aims to position itself as a preferred destination for venture capital investments. Key components of the Texas Venture Capital Package include: 1. Texas Entrepreneur Networks: This program establishes a network of experienced entrepreneurs, industry experts, and investors who provide guidance, mentorship, and access to funding opportunities for early-stage startups and entrepreneurs. These networks facilitate connections and knowledge sharing, increasing the likelihood of successful investments. 2. Texas Investment Tax Credit: As part of the package, Texas offers a tax credit to incentivize venture capital investments made in qualifying businesses. This tax credit encourages venture capitalists to invest in innovative startups and emerging companies operating in key industries such as biotechnology, clean energy, information technology, and advanced manufacturing. 3. Texas Emerging Technology Funds: The Texas Venture Capital Package includes the establishment of funds specifically designed to support emerging technology companies. These funds provide capital to startups aiming to commercialize cutting-edge technologies, accelerate research and development, and bring innovative products to market. The funds are managed by experienced investment professionals who evaluate investment opportunities and allocate resources accordingly. 4. Texas Innovation Centers: These centers serve as collaborative hubs for startups, entrepreneurs, and investors. They provide physical spaces, resources, and networking opportunities, fostering a vibrant ecosystem for innovation and venture capital activity. Innovation centers often offer access to incubator and accelerator programs, mentorship, educational workshops, and industry partnerships. 5. Texas Equity Crowdfunding: The Texas Venture Capital Package includes provisions for equity crowdfunding, allowing entrepreneurs to raise capital from a wider pool of investors. This alternative financing method enables startups to showcase their potential to a broader audience and attract smaller individual investments. Equity crowdfunding platforms operating within Texas comply with regulations to protect both investors and entrepreneurs. 6. Sector-specific initiatives: The Texas Venture Capital Package recognizes the importance of focusing on specific industries to harness their potential for growth and innovation. In line with this approach, there are dedicated programs and resources tailored for sectors like healthcare, energy, aerospace, and information technology. These initiatives provide specialized support and attract targeted venture capital investments for sector-specific startups and companies. By implementing the Texas Venture Capital Package, the state aims to catalyze economic growth, encourage entrepreneurship, and position itself as a leading center for innovation and investment. The initiative demonstrates Texas's commitment to fostering a vibrant startup ecosystem and creating opportunities for companies to access the capital they need to thrive.
